Transaction ec552c649632d7999f652a774c7f7a141a592c45060e222cee807927d8a128f9
1 Input
1 Output
-
ec552c649632d7999f652a774c7f7a141a592c45060e222cee807927d8a128f9:0
- value
- 1586463
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 65db91f052fa49f63ad5f6a3d062cca5b75e730a OP_EQUAL
- address
- 3AybCv1ZEw1ucpoAAtAPLWrMuECMGMyiu4